interlacustrine, a.|ɪntələˈkʌstrɪn| [f. inter- 4 a + lacustrine a.] Lying between lakes.
1900Geogr. Jrnl. Feb. 179 This region forms part of the great interlacustrine plateau. 1958E. Winter in Middleton & Tait Tribes without Rulers 158 The other Interlacustrine kingdoms of which the best known is Buganda. |
